select the correct answer.which best describes a step in the process of using folding paper to bisect \\( \overline { a b } \\)?a. fold the paper such that point a and point b are next to one another.b. fold the paper such that point a and point b coincide with one another.c. fold the paper such that point a and point b are at right angles.d. fold the paper such that point a and point b are on parallel lines.
When bisecting a line segment \(\overline{AB}\) using paper - folding, the key is to make the two endpoints \(A\) and \(B\) coincide. This folding action will create a crease that is the perpendicular bisector of \(\overline{AB}\).
- Option A: Folding \(A\) and \(B\) next to one another does not guarantee that the segment is bisected.
- Option C: Making \(A\) and \(B\) at right angles has no relation to bisecting the segment \(\overline{AB}\).
- Option D: Placing \(A\) and \(B\) on parallel lines is not relevant to bisecting the line segment \(\overline{AB}\).
